Which of the following statements is incorrect ?

A

The ionization potential of nitrogen is greater than of oxygen

B

The electron affinity of fluorine is greater than of chlorine .

C

The ionization potential of Mg is greater than aluminium

D

The electronegativity of fluorine is greater than that of chlorine

To solve the question "Which of the following statements is incorrect?", we will analyze each of the statements provided in the options. ### Step-by-Step Solution: 1. **Statement 1: The ionization potential of nitrogen is greater than that of oxygen.** - **Analysis:** - Ionization potential (or ionization energy) is the energy required to remove an electron from an atom in its gaseous state. - Nitrogen (atomic number 7) has the electronic configuration of 1s² 2s² 2p³, while oxygen (atomic number 8) has the electronic configuration of 1s² 2s² 2p⁴. - Nitrogen has a half-filled 2p subshell, which provides extra stability. Thus, it is harder to remove an electron from nitrogen than from oxygen. - **Conclusion:** This statement is **true**. 2. **Statement 2: The electron affinity of chlorine is greater than that of fluorine.** - **Analysis:** - Electron affinity is the energy change when an electron is added to a neutral atom. - Fluorine (atomic number 9) has a smaller atomic size compared to chlorine (atomic number 17). Although fluorine is more electronegative, its small size leads to significant electron-electron repulsion when an additional electron is added. - Chlorine, being larger, can accommodate an additional electron more easily, hence has a higher electron affinity. - **Conclusion:** This statement is **incorrect**. 3. **Statement 3: The ionization potential of magnesium is greater than that of aluminum.** - **Analysis:** - Magnesium (atomic number 12) has the electronic configuration of 1s² 2s² 2p⁶ 3s², while aluminum (atomic number 13) has the configuration of 1s² 2s² 2p⁶ 3s² 3p¹. - Magnesium has a completely filled 3s subshell, which provides extra stability, making it harder to remove an electron compared to aluminum. - **Conclusion:** This statement is **true**. 4. **Statement 4: The electronegativity of fluorine is greater than that of chlorine.** - **Analysis:** - Electronegativity is the tendency of an atom to attract electrons in a bond. - Fluorine is the most electronegative element due to its small size and high effective nuclear charge, making it more effective at attracting electrons compared to chlorine. - **Conclusion:** This statement is **true**. ### Final Answer: The incorrect statement is **Statement 2: The electron affinity of chlorine is greater than that of fluorine.**
